A recent report by the U.S. Government Accountability Office (GAO) has brought to light some serious lapses by the U.S. Secret Service regarding the attempted assassination of President Donald Trump on July 13, 2024, at a campaign rally in Butler, Pennsylvania. The investigation was initiated by Senate Judiciary Committee Chairman Chuck Grassley, who discovered that crucial intelligence about a threat to Trump’s life was received a full ten days before the rally but was not shared with local law enforcement or Trump’s security team. As Senator Grassley aptly put it, the situation stemmed from “a series of bad decisions and bureaucratic handicaps.”

The GAO report is quite revealing, indicating that the Secret Service’s failure on that day was due to systemic issues that have been festering for years. The report outlines various issues, such as the “misallocation of resources, lack of training, and pervasive communication failures.” Local police informed investigators that they would have increased their presence if they had been aware of the imminent threat. The Secret Service’s denial of extra security requests for the Butler event, despite the threat’s credibility, adds another layer of concern.

The GAO describes internal failures in the days leading up to the rally, worrying lawmakers and security experts alike. One particularly troubling fact is the inexperience of the agent responsible for assessing vulnerabilities at the rally site. The agent was new to the role and had no previous experience planning protective operations for presidential events.

The report notes that Trump almost missed crucial counter-sniper support that ultimately neutralized the would-be assassin, Thomas Matthew Crooks. The Secret Service turned down the Trump Protective Division’s request for advanced counter Unmanned Aerial Surveillance (cUAS) equipment and sniper teams, claiming those resources were already reserved for the National Conventions. Only senior officials, aware of the specific threat, intervened to provide the necessary counter-sniper resources.

This decision was labeled “inconsistent” with established agency practices, and it was highlighted that without the last-minute approval, Trump likely wouldn’t have had the counter-sniper assets that subdued Crooks. During an interview preview with his daughter-in-law, Lara Trump, President Trump shared that the situation could have been much worse without those sniper teams.

In reaction to the incident, six Secret Service agents have faced suspension as part of the disciplinary measures. However, the report raises significant concerns about whether the key decision-makers, who failed to communicate vital intelligence or allocate proper resources, are still working within the agency.

The GAO’s findings have sparked a renewed call in Congress for accountability within the Secret Service. Lawmakers are now pushing for assurances that similar security lapses will not occur in the future. They are also demanding clarity on whether systemic changes have been implemented and if those responsible for critical failures have been removed from decision-making positions.
